VHP exhibits a novel and top-quality mode of action[1] for microbial destruction. Even though liquid hydrogen peroxide solutions are successful, VHP demonstrates an enhanced ability to oxidize important mobile factors of microorganisms, which includes proteins, lipids and DNA at lessen concentrations.

You could be asking yourself how what is vhp sterilization instrument sets could get that chilly. Even though it varies, the key result in may be the air flow programs. When devices are positioned beneath an air conditioning vent the cooled air blowing on to tables and devices can be cooler than the general place temperature.
PIC/S6 gives four choices for the evaluation from the spore log reduction (SLR). The main two involve the elimination of surviving spores in the provider and both instantly enumerating, or culturing aliquots inside of a liquid medium for a Most Probable Quantity (MPN) estimation. Another two incorporate a two-BI process where just one unit is cultured and the other held in reserve (the held BI is instantly enumerated only if the cultured BI is constructive for growth) and And finally, the usage of triplicate BIs to get a MPN estimation. The first two procedures are really labor intensive and are rarely applied.
